Abstract
A knock sensor signal processing apparatus for an engine, which performs a series of A/D conversions of a knock sensor signal during each of successive knock judgement intervals to obtain A/D converted values for use in judging if engine knocking is occurring in a cylinder, derives compensation coefficients during an interval between the end of a knock judgement interval corresponding to a cylinder and the start of deriving knock sensor signal A/D values in a succeeding knock judgement interval for a succeeding cylinder, and applies these coefficients to correct the A/D converted values derived in the second knock judgement interval.
